Company Description

AbCellera Biologics Inc. (Nasdaq: ABCL) is a clinical-stage biotechnology company in the pharmaceutical preparation manufacturing industry. According to its public disclosures, AbCellera focuses on discovering and developing antibody-based medicines in the areas of endocrinology, women’s health, immunology, and oncology. The company describes itself as an antibody discovery and development engine designed to overcome barriers in conventional discovery and to identify clinical candidates with greater precision and speed.

AbCellera states that its integrated platform combines proprietary hardware, software, tools, and data science. Using this platform, its experts search large and diverse antibody repertoires to identify effective and developable leads. The company reports that it has extensive experience forming partnerships with emerging biotechnology and pharmaceutical companies, where it participates in discovery efforts and may share in downstream success through milestone fees and royalties or royalty equivalents.

Business model and partnership-focused approach

Based on its own descriptions and key business metrics, AbCellera’s model centers on partner-initiated programs with downstream participation. The company tracks “partner-initiated program starts with downstreams” as a core metric, defining these as unique partner programs where AbCellera has commenced antibody discovery and stands to participate financially in future success. It views the cumulative number of such programs as an indicator of its total opportunities to earn downstream revenue over the mid- to long-term.

AbCellera also tracks “molecules in the clinic,” defined as unique molecules that have reached an open or approved regulatory status for clinical trials based on antibodies discovered by AbCellera or by partners using licensed AbCellera technology. The company states that this metric reflects its potential to generate milestone and possible royalty revenue as partnered programs advance through clinical development.

Therapeutic focus and internal pipeline

AbCellera describes itself as a clinical-stage company with internal programs in multiple therapeutic areas aligned with its focus on endocrinology, women’s health, immunology, and oncology. In its business updates, the company highlights two lead internal antibody programs:

  • ABCL635, a potential first-in-class, non-hormonal antibody medicine for the treatment of moderate-to-severe vasomotor symptoms (VMS) associated with menopause, commonly known as hot flashes. ABCL635 targets NK3R, a clinically validated G protein-coupled receptor (GPCR) expressed on KNDy neurons in the hypothalamus. AbCellera reports that ABCL635 is the first program from its GPCR and ion channel platform to advance into the pipeline and that it has entered a Phase 1/2 clinical trial, including a randomized Phase 2 proof-of-concept study in postmenopausal women.
  • ABCL575, described as an Fc-silenced, half-life extended investigational antibody therapy being developed for the treatment of moderate-to-severe atopic dermatitis (AD), with potential applications for other inflammatory and autoimmune conditions. ABCL575 binds OX40 ligand (OX40L) to disrupt OX40/OX40L signaling, which AbCellera identifies as a regulator of inflammatory pathways in AD. In preclinical work, the company reports potent inhibition of T cell–mediated inflammatory pathways, a favorable safety profile, and an in vivo half-life expected to support less frequent dosing than current clinical-stage molecules. ABCL575 has entered a rand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led Phase 1 clinical trial in healthy participants.

These internal programs illustrate how AbCellera applies its antibody discovery capabilities to build a pipeline in women’s health and immunology, while also maintaining a broader partnered portfolio across additional indications.

Clinical-stage operations and manufacturing

In its quarterly business results, AbCellera characterizes itself as a clinical-stage biotechnology company. The company has reported progress in advancing its lead programs through Phase 1 clinical studies and in building its broader pipeline. It has also noted the start of activities at a new clinical manufacturing facility, which it associates with the substantial completion of its platform investments. These disclosures indicate that AbCellera is not only focused on discovery but is also building capabilities to support early-stage clinical development and manufacturing of antibody-based medicines.

Geographic and regulatory profile

AbCellera Biologics Inc. is organized under the laws of British Columbia and reports that its principal executive offices are located in Vancouver, British Columbia. The company’s common shares trade on Nasdaq under the symbol ABCL, and it files reports with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ission under Commission File Number 001-39781. Its SEC filings identify it as operating in the pharmaceutical preparation manufacturing industry within the broader manufacturing sector.

AbCellera has reported involvement in patent litigation relating to technology used in antibody discovery. In a disclosed material event, the company announced a settlement and patent license agreement with Bruker Corporation, resolving litigation between the two companies globally. Under that agreement, AbCellera stated that Bruker would make an upfront payment and future royalty payments on sales of certain Bruker platform products for the life of the licensed patents. This settlement illustrates how AbCellera seeks to protect and monetize its intellectual property and technology platforms.
